Transaction 43b90df0b8828f35b13bc374b2d0a482a9958b2f3dc024ff2b29e5cfb3f530e3

4 Input
1 Outputs
  • 43b90df0b8828f35b13bc374b2d0a482a9958b2f3dc024ff2b29e5cfb3f530e3:0
  • value  19052761
    address  35fZCpi8W6621hSMZv2AaX5KP4wAJbESW5